TikTok is on a rampage, expanding into music, online purchases, search engines, fulfillment centers, and warehouses to rival not only Instagram, Facebook, and Google, but eventually Spotify, Apple Music, and Amazon. TikTok, and the Chinese regime that controls it, would like to be America’s “everything app,” an idea that Elon Musk is thinking about, too.
